Keep the mechanisms. Drop the identity. Born on May 7, 1990, in Cairo, Egypt, Rashwan attended Columbia University. He met his future co-founder Ophelia Snyder in 2011 in San Francisco where they discovered bitcoin. He founded Payout.com in late 2014, providing online lenders with a payouts and disbursements API. The company went through the AngelPad accelerator and raised $4.75M. In 2018, he co-founded 21.co (formerly Amun), which launched the first physically backed cryptocurrency ETP on the SIX Swiss Exchange.

  1. 2008 · age 18Enrolled at Ohio State University

    Began studying economics and computer science at Ohio State University before transferring to Columbia University.

  2. 2012 · age 22Founded Ribbon

    Founded social commerce company Ribbon, which built the first in-stream 'buy buttons' on Twitter and Facebook.

  3. 2014 · age 24Founded Payout.com

    Left Columbia University to found Payout.com, an enterprise fintech providing payouts and compliance APIs for online lenders.

  4. 2015 · age 25AngelPad Accelerator

    Payout.com completed the AngelPad accelerator program and began processing loans for clients like LendUp and Prosper.
